The field sales optimization industry is experiencing robust growth driven by the increasing demand for efficient and data-driven sales operations. Companies are adopting SaaS solutions to improve productivity, reduce costs, and enhance customer interactions for their field teams. AI and advanced analytics are key trends, allowing for better lead generation and strategic planning. The market is competitive but offers significant opportunities for innovation.

The CCPA, significantly expanded by the California Privacy Rights Act (CPRA) in 2023, grants consumers more control over their personal information collected by businesses, including the right to know, delete, and opt-out of the sale or sharing of their data.
This policy requires Lead Mapper to implement robust data privacy safeguards and transparent data handling practices, potentially affecting how lead generation and location data are managed and shared.
While not US-specific, GDPR influences global data practices, including those of US companies interacting with EU citizens, by setting stringent rules for data collection, storage, and processing, emphasizing user consent and data protection.
Lead Mapper must ensure its data practices, especially concerning any international user data or lead generation activities, comply with GDPR's high standards, potentially requiring adjustments to data consent and storage mechanisms.
The TSR, enforced by the FTC, governs telemarketing calls in the US, including rules on Do Not Call registries, call abandonment, and disclosures, with recent amendments focusing on robocalls and spoofing.
Lead Mapper's AI-powered lead generation feature must ensure its identified leads and outreach methods adhere to TSR regulations, particularly regarding unsolicited communications and consent, to avoid legal penalties.
